**Handover: soft deletes on orders — from Priya-side to you**

Welcome aboard! Quick thing before I'm out: the Cartwheel orders table uses soft deletes. Rows get a deleted_at timestamp, nothing is ever hard-deleted except by the nightly purge job. Always filter deleted rows in queries or reports will double-count. The purge job runs with these settings.

deployment values, kajep-kageg:
[praix]
host = praix.paliqcorp.corp
user = praix_svc
database = praix_prod

## Queue-Depth Autoscaler: Limits and Quotas

The Oakmire autoscaler watches backlog depth on the ingest queues and adjusts worker replicas within hard floors and ceilings. Scale decisions are rate-limited to avoid thrash, and cooldowns differ for scale-up versus scale-down. Maintainers changing these values must update the runbook. Current limits are defined as follows.

tuning table, yajog-yahof:
BUDGETS = {
    "lamvan": 303,
    "wenox": 460,
    "fenvan": 525,
}

Vendor note — Restock planner (Corvello Vending)

The restock planner for the Harwick Campus machines is maintained under the Corvello contract, renewed annually each March. Route forecasts come from the Pellway demand model; do not edit the CSV exports by hand, as the planner re-syncs nightly and will overwrite changes. If a machine is flagged empty three cycles in a row, open a ticket with the vendor rather than adjusting thresholds. For contract questions or SLA disputes, the Corvello account team can be reached at the address below.

escalation mailbox, fawep-tahop: quenvan@nelvrostack.internal